As a Senior Project Manager at London Gatwick, each day brings unique challenges. You'll be able to lead strategic projects across our entire customer journey.

London Gatwick serves millions of customers each year, and how they experience our airport is at the heart of everything we do. From driving on local roads, parking in our car parks, checking in, passing through security, and shopping in our departure lounges, we ensure a seamless and enjoyable travel experience at every step.

From concept to execution, as a Project Manager, you'll have the opportunity to lead the full project lifecycle on a wide variety of impactful projects, in a live environment, and be instrumental in shaping the future of one of the world's busiest airports.

Our projects vary across the airport, with our smaller works division delivering projects ranging from 500k to 20m. The current project portfolio ranges from retail unit refurbishments and fit-outs, International Departure Lounges (IDL) refurbishments with full FFE, and dilapidated buildings needing to be updated to meet our NetZero commitment.

Therole

Reporting directly to the Programme Manager and working in a leadership role supporting a dedicated team of 20+ professionals, you will take ownership of the technical, commercial, and financial management of large projects or sub-programmes, ensuring successful delivery against project and business goals. With a mechanical, electrical, or building services bias, you will be the subject matter expert with an ability to balance attention to detail with strong leadership qualities, driving outcomes and inspiring your team.

Other duties include:

  • Taking ownership of the identification and mitigation of risks that may adversely impact project delivery or adversely affect airport operations through the project/programme lifecycle.
  • Overseeing the successful handover of assigned projects to Operations and/or Commercial Departments including ensuring all requisite Airport Operational Readiness planning and activities are in place.
  • Developing, motivating, and coaching staff within the project team, recognising talent and assisting the development of those with high potential.
  • Ensuring compliance with all process, legal and statutory obligations applicable to this role, including all standards and code compliance, and required planning permissions.
  • Identifying lessons learnt across all projects and embedding a culture of continuous improvement.
  • Developing and maintaining a culture of world class health, safety, and environmental standards across the projects, delivering the highest levels of health, safety and environmental performance achievable.

What are we looking for?

The live environment at Gatwick requires all our teams to have a flexible and adaptable approach, with exceptional problem solving skills and an ability to engage and influence stakeholders at all levels.

As well as an in-depth knowledge of Health, Safety and Environmental regulations within the Construction industry, this role requires:

  • A Degree or equivalent in programme management, engineering, or a construction related field
  • Experience as a senior project manager or project manager on large, multi-year MEPH (mechanical, electrical, plumbing and heating) projects, with a value typically in excess of 20m
  • Experience leading and developing teams
  • Experience leading infrastructure projects in a live operational environment
  • Working knowledge and understanding of contract administration and negotiations
